Finding the best car dent repair shop near you

If you’re looking for the best car dent repair shop near you, there are a few things you need to know.

First, do a little research on Yelp, Google, and local business reviews.

Second, ask around your family, friends, and coworkers. Ask if anyone has been to local car dent repair shops.

Third, find a mechanic you trust and go there when necessary repairs are done.

Tips for finding a good auto body shop

If you want to repair your car, you’re probably wondering how to find a good auto body shop. While many people assume that the best way to find a good auto body shop is by going to your local dealership, this isn’t necessarily true. There are several reasons why this may not be the best option.

First, most dealerships only want to sell you the most expensive service. They don’t want to help you save money, so they won’t tell you about a better auto body shop that’s closer to you.

Second, the quality of your auto body shop will depend on the company’s reputation. As a result, it’s best to ask for recommendations from people you know and trust.

Third, many auto body shops in your area are probably not licensed to perform auto body repair services. If this is the case, they won’t be able to provide you with the service you want.

Fourth, many auto body shops near you cannot provide the same quality of service as the best. They might not even be able to provide a service. All these factors mean you must look at various options to find a good auto body shop.

What to look for in a good auto body shop

When you need auto body repairs, you’ll probably need a professional. An auto body shop is unlike a local garage, where you can pop in and pick up a repair estimate.

When you go to an auto body shop, you’re probably going to need to get some advice on how to choose a good auto body shop. That’s why we’ve put together this list of factors to look for in a good auto body shop.

Location – This is the most important factor. You’ll probably need the auto body shop to visit your house or office. You may want to consider another auto body shop if they’re unwilling to do that.

Experience – If you’re looking for an auto body shop to fix your car, you’ll need to know that they’ve fixed other similar vehicles. You’ll also need to see if they’re certified by an organization like the Better Business Bureau.

Reputation—You’ll want to check out Relp, Google, and other reviews to see if customers have had a positive experience with the auto body shop.

Costs—You’ll want to ensure you’re not being exploited. Ensure you get a written estimate that includes all the repairs’ costs.
